The following statements compare American University of Puerto Rico and South University-Richmond with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Both schools are private.
- South University-Richmond's tuition ($16,452) is more expensive than American University of Puerto Rico ($7,056).
- Both schools have same students to faculty ratio of 11 to 1.
- South University-Richmond (417 students) is larger than American University of Puerto Rico (223 students) with more enrolled students.
- American University of Puerto Rico ($9,853) has higher amount of financial aid than South University-Richmond ($5,731).
- American University of Puerto Rico's graduation rate (24%) is higher than South University-Richmond (21%).
